Tip 76See a Big Long List of Your Contacts

Here’s a tip that lets you view all your contacts in a long list, alongside which you’ll be able to see each contact’s email address or their telephone number(s). It uses a debug setting within the Contacts app.

  1. Close the Contacts app if it’s open, open a Terminal window (open Finder, select the Applications list, and then in the list of applications double-click Terminal within the Utilities folder), and type the following:

     
    defaults write com.apple.AddressBook ABShowDebugMenu -bool true
  2. Open Contacts, and you should see a new Debug menu option. Select the Show People Picker Panel option. This will open a new window showing all your contacts in one long list with their email addresses alongside.
